Задать вопрос
@arturios571

Как достучаться до элемента classa подписанного на суб протокол?

Подскажите пож как правильно сделать что бы я мог достучаться до expired ) Новичок не пинайте сина, спасибо )!
5f4ca5035dbd47b79715a7845f6d4810.png
  • Вопрос задан
  • 57 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Академия Eduson
    IOS-Разработчик
    7 месяцев
    Далее
  • Нетология
    iOS-разработчик с нуля
    11 месяцев
    Далее
  • Яндекс Практикум
    iOS-разработчик
    10 месяцев
    Далее
Решения вопроса 1
@arturios571 Автор вопроса
var fridge = [Storable]()//пустой массив типа Storable холодильник

for prod in basket {
if let storableProduct = prod as? Storable where storableProduct.expired == false {
fridge.append(storableProduct)
}

Может кому пригодиться
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 1
В Swift 3, синтаксис нескольких условий в одном if let изменился:
if let storableProduct = prod as? Storable, storableProduct.expired == false {
    fridge.append(storableProduct)
}

При этом в for, while, switch по-прежнему используется where.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ы